f(x) = -4x and g(x) = 5x-13, find f(g(x))

Respuesta :

wegnerkolmp2741o
wegnerkolmp2741o wegnerkolmp2741o
  • 14-12-2018

Answer:

-20x +52

Step-by-step explanation:

To solve this, we put the function g(x) into the function f(x) in the place of x

Put 5x-3 in for x in -4x

f(g(x)) = -4 (5x-13)

       = -4*5x -4(-13)

       = -20x +52
